Where Would You Even Put a Native App?

No Google Play listing. No App Store entry. No .apk file to download free. Shuffle does not attempt to simulate a native experience or disguise a PWA as a download — the help centre states it plainly: “browser-based and fully responsive — no app download required.” Every feature listed — games, deposits, withdrawals, challenges, VIP tracking, live support — runs through the mobile browser.

Your Shortcut in Three Steps

iOS — Safari:

  1. Pull up shuffle.com and log in.
  2. Share icon → “Add to Home Screen.”
  3. One tap next time — a standalone window opens with no browser chrome. Your session flows into the shortcut.

Android — Chrome:

  1. Head to shuffle.com in Chrome.
  2. Three-dot menu → “Add to Home Screen” → confirm.
  3. The Shuffle icon lands on your home screen — credentials carry forward.

Is Shuffle Safe Without a Native App?

Shuffle is crypto-only, which shifts the trust framework. There is no card processor or banking intermediary — your deposits move wallet-to-wallet. The help centre splits into ten categories with article counts visible: Sign Up and Verification (2), Bonuses (24), Deposits & Withdrawals (8), Account & Security (5), VIP & Affiliate Program (4), Promotions (5), Game Information (5), Token (5), Provably Fair (5) and SHFL Lottery (4).

Seventy-seven help articles in total — a depth that most platforms with dedicated apps do not match.

A Provably Fair section occupies its own help category, confirming cryptographic game verification is a core platform feature rather than marketing text.

What You Navigate on Mobile

The left sidebar holds twelve entries: Casino and Sports as a toggle pair, then Crash Games, VIP Status, Promotions, Slots, Live Casino, Table Games, Instant Games, Blackjack, Rewards and VIP.

A filter bar offers: Lobby, Popular, By Provider, Live Casino, Exclusives, Slot Machines and more. “Exclusives” filters for Shuffle-only titles.

Seven content sections stack down the page: Shuffle Games (Dice, Mines, Money, Limbo, Plinko, Hilo, Blitz — all proprietary), Slots, Live Casino, a Providers strip (Hacksaw, Pragmatic Play, Evolution and others), Game Shows, Shuffle Picks and Latest Releases.

➔ The Shuffle Games rail deserves attention. Seven house-built titles with the platform’s own branding — Dice, Mines, Plinko, Limbo, Hilo, Money, Blitz. These are not white-labelled third-party games. They run on Shuffle’s own infrastructure, which ties directly into the Provably Fair verification system. A sports section with live betting tables and accumulator tools fills the lower half of the homepage.

FAQ

Can I deposit fiat currency at Shuffle?

No. Shuffle is a crypto-only platform. Deposits and withdrawals move wallet-to-wallet. There are no Visa, Mastercard or bank transfer options. The help centre’s most viewed article is “Assets Supported for Deposits and Withdrawals.”

What are Shuffle Originals?

Seven proprietary games — Dice, Mines, Money, Limbo, Plinko, Hilo and Blitz — developed in-house and running on Shuffle’s own infrastructure. All are covered by the platform’s Provably Fair verification system.
